Submission + - New Chemical Process Can Convert Approx. A Quarter of All Plastic Waste to Fuel (vice.com)
dmoberhaus writes: Researchers at Purdue University have developed a new chemical process that they say can convert approximately one-quarter of the world's plastic waste into gasoline and diesel-like fuels. Motherboard explains how it works.
